Concept of the Slovenian maritime affairs
Pojam pomorstva u Sloveniji
In order to presents its comprehensive meaning, this paper first defines the semantic concept of maritime affairs, then it goes on to provide the historical view of the Mediterranean, so as to understand how some of the most ancient civilizations flourished there. Next, the importance of the sea to the economic, political, social and cultural life of different nations is presented, followed by the current issues of maritime affairs in the European Union (EU). A particular focus is given to the Mediterranean region being an enclosed and heavily marine-exploited sea. Recent efforts of the European Commission encouraging a far-reaching reorganization of maritime affairs in Europe by integrating maritime policy for the EU and exploring synergies to avoid overlaps between the existing policies that deal with sea-related issues are pointed out. Finally, Slovenia is placed in this context by showing excellent opportunities the Slovenian presidency offers in order to reconsider its own long-neglected maritime policy.
